Output e5984120914277423c4a5f0ad30ec1ecd6042a8fba64f606430187d2e098cd1f:5

value
169640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30b7c39feef3098bcb7c7a84cf9b94be3a8f348c OP_EQUAL
address
368cVuguhX4gMsLq7UfpDnfjQaxyfDZiB7
transaction
e5984120914277423c4a5f0ad30ec1ecd6042a8fba64f606430187d2e098cd1f
spent
true